Are roofs in GU28 suitable?
Our data shows that 86% of properties in this area have pitched roofs, which are typically ideal for solar arrays.

Do I need planning permission in Petworth?
Generally, solar panel installations in Petworth are considered 'Permitted Development' and do not require planning permission, provided they do not protrude more than 200mm from the roof slope. Exceptions apply if you live in a listed building.
